Transaction 789edae14b785520a13170f3770f40b962483604a091198ad72e2d804a488c46

1 Input
2 Outputs
  • 789edae14b785520a13170f3770f40b962483604a091198ad72e2d804a488c46:0
  • value  3811753
    address  3AsgPS4YY9XaeufVndkFovmtNtW2YDMnCU
  • 789edae14b785520a13170f3770f40b962483604a091198ad72e2d804a488c46:1
  • value  125000
    address  38NAwNKsiDNYRwcdkpGAtGNSB17mPLBpT2